From: Armin Novak Date: Wed, 8 Jan 2020 14:42:20 +0000 (+0100) Subject: Fallback definition for LIBUSB_HOTPLUG_NO_FLAGS X-Git-Tag: 2.0.0~202^2~1 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=b0de74cad235448a70f46e9e11c57ea8c52931d9;p=platform%2Fupstream%2Ffreerdp.git Fallback definition for LIBUSB_HOTPLUG_NO_FLAGS The flag was first introduced with libusb 1.0.16, so define it if we are using an older version. Signed-off-by: Armin Novak --- diff --git a/channels/urbdrc/client/libusb/libusb_udevman.c b/channels/urbdrc/client/libusb/libusb_udevman.c index 8f4f8cc..74e86b5 100644 --- a/channels/urbdrc/client/libusb/libusb_udevman.c +++ b/channels/urbdrc/client/libusb/libusb_udevman.c @@ -34,6 +34,10 @@ #include "libusb_udevice.h" +#if LIBUSB_API_VERSION < 0x01000102 +#define LIBUSB_HOTPLUG_NO_FLAGS 0 +#endif + #define BASIC_STATE_FUNC_DEFINED(_arg, _type) \ static _type udevman_get_##_arg(IUDEVMAN* idevman) \ { \